Technical Problem

Existing robot joint actuators have increased size due to the addition of a flange between the torque sensor and the reducer, which hinders the miniaturization of robot joints.

Method used

An isolation section is installed between the torque sensor and the reducer. By embedding the isolation section inside the actuator cavity, the size of the actuator is reduced, and potting compound is used to isolate the strain gauge from the grease, thereby reducing weight and volume.

Benefits of technology

This technology enables miniaturization of the actuator, improves the precision and stability of the robot joint module, simplifies the assembly process, and reduces the axial dimension and weight of the actuator.

Abstract

This application provides an actuator including a torque sensor, the torque sensor including a strain gauge and a deformation portion for mounting the strain gauge, the actuator further including a reducer, a first connecting portion, a second connecting portion, and an isolation portion, the isolation portion being located between the reducer and the torque sensor, the isolation portion being connected to the first connecting portion and sealing at the connection, the isolation portion being connected to the second connecting portion and sealing at the connection, the actuator having a first cavity, the cavity wall forming the first cavity including at least the wall of the deformation portion, the isolation portion being located in the first cavity, by embedding the isolation portion inside the first cavity, the volume of the actuator can be reduced.
